The investigators aim to investigate whether intravenous anesthetic drug dosage requirement is increased in patients with insomnia undergoing digestive endoscopy compared with normal sleep patterns.

No interventions, this study is to compare the dosage requirement of intravenous anesthetic drug during digestive endoscopy between insomnia group and normal sleep group.
Time frame: Up to 1 day
The total consumption of intravenous anesthetic drug for digestive endoscopy. It includes the total amount of intravenous anesthesia drugs required by the patient for the entire process of digestive endoscopy.
Time frame: 1 day
The dosage of intravenous anesthetic drug for successful insertion of digestive endoscope
Time frame: The day for patients undergoing digestive endoscopy and 24 hours after the digestive endoscopy
The occurrence of the respiratory and cardiovascular adverse events such as hypoxemia, hypotension, hypertension, arrhythmia
Time frame: The day for patients undergoing digestive endoscopy and 24 hours after the digestive endoscopy
The occurrence of the other adverse events such as dizziness, agitation, nausea, vomiting and psychiatric symptom
Time frame: The day for patients undergoing digestive endoscopy and 24 hours after the digestive endoscopy
The patient is conscious after anesthesia
Time frame: Up to 1 day
The time from when the patient stops intravenous anesthetic drug application to when they can open their eyes and nod their heads.
Time frame: Up to 1 day
Patients' stay time in PACU
Time frame: Up to 1 day
The ease of operation at this level of sedation (easy/medium/difficult) evaluated by the gastroenterologists
Time frame: Up to 1 day
The satisfaction degree of anesthesia effect (satisfactory/medium/unsatisfactory) evaluated by the gastroenterologists
Time frame: Up to 1 day
Patients' satisfaction with the procedure at this level of sedation (satisfactory/medium/unsatisfactory)
Time frame: Up to 1 day
Patients' willingness to undergo the next procedure at the same level of sedation
